# Welcome, plugin authors!

Glad you're building on FeedCheckly, our podcast feed validator. Plugins get called after the core XML pass, so you only see feeds that already parse — your job is the fun stuff like enclosure checks and chapter validation. To test locally, spin up the sandbox with `feedcheckly dev`, drop your plugin in the `plugins/` folder, and you're off. The sandbox also needs access to the fixtures database of sample feeds, which it reaches via the following connection string.

primary connection of yagep-kahip = redis://giliel_svc:zYiKsLL2PLpfPL@db-348f.xolmarsys.corp:5432/fenwyn

## Authentication

Splitpane, our diff viewer for large files, fetches blob chunks from the Hardline storage service. All requests must carry a service token; anonymous reads were disabled last quarter. New team members should use the shared staging credential until their personal token is provisioned. The current staging key is below.

service key, fawip-bajef: kto11_Qt5wZK9vdNC

## Deployment

ProctorQ handles the exam-proctoring queue. Deploys go through the Ashgrove pipeline: merge to main, wait for the canary, then promote. Never deploy during an active exam window — check the schedule board first. Rollbacks are one command; see the ops doc. The queue workers read the following configuration at startup.

settings of tagef-bawif:
DRUIX_HOST=druix.zemvarlabs.internal
DRUIX_PORT=8000

## Ownership

The clock-skew monitor for the Quarrylight build farm lives in this repo. Build agents occasionally drift more than the 250ms tolerance, which breaks artifact timestamp ordering and causes the Slatebird scheduler to mark runs as flaky. If support sees skew alerts, first check the NTP sidecar logs, then escalate rather than restarting agents manually — restarts mask the drift without fixing it. Questions about the monitor, its thresholds, or the escalation path go to the component owner listed below.

account owner for kagag-yahap: Novath Quenok